TheconsequencesofarapidlywarmingArcticwillbefeltfarafield
ThelatestwordfromscientistsstudyingtheArcticisthatthepolarregioniswarmingtwiceasfastastheaverageriseontherestoftheplanet.Andresearcherssaythetrendisn'tlettingup.That'sthelatestfromthe2014ArcticReportCard—acompilationofrecentresearchfrommorethan60scientistsin13countries.ThereportwasreleasedWednesdaybytheNationalOceanicandAtmosphericAdministration.
JackieRichter-Menge,apolarscientistwiththeU.S.ArmyCorpsofEngineerswhocollaboratedwithNOAAontheanalysis,saysthefindingsdemonstratethe"powerofpersistence"intheArctic—"persistenceinthewarmingairtemperaturesandtheimpactthatishavingonthisicyenvironment."
That'slargelybecauseofarcticamplification.Here'showitworks:
Normally,snowandicecoolthesurfacebyreflectingalotofthesun'senergybackupintotheatmosphere.Butwarmingairtemperaturesmeltsnowandice."Andwhentheymelt,"saysRichter-Menge,"theyexposedarkerregions."
Darkerregions,oncecoveredinsnowandice,nowabsorbmoreheat,likeadarkshirtdoesonahot,sunnyday.Thesamethinghappenswhenseaicemelts—theexposedwaterisdarkerandwarmsup.
Sowhathappensasaresultofthisamplification?
Well,warmerwateraffectswhatlivesinit.Apparently,planktonlikethewarmerconditions;they'rethriving.Scientistssaytheydon'tknowwhetherthat'sgoodorbadfortherestofus.Butunlikeplankton,polarbearsdon'tlikethewarmerwaterandhavinglessseaicearound.
"There'sastrongconnectionbetweenwhat'sgoingonwiththeseaandpolarbears,"saysRichter-Menge.Inregionswheretheseaiceisholdingsteady,bearsaredoingOK,accordingtothereportcard.Wheretheiceisgone,bearnumbersaredown.
Thenthere'sGreenland.Thegiantlandmassiscoveredinicethat'samilethick.GeophysicistBeataCsathoattheUniversityatBuffalohasjustcompletedthemostcomprehensivesatellitesurveyofthaticecover.
"Therearesomeplaces,"shesays,"whereinthelast20yearstheicesurfaceisjustlowering,lowering,loweringveryuniformly."
Csatho,whoseresearchappearsseparatelyintheProceedingsoftheNationalAcademyofSciencesthisweek,saysshehasnoticedsomethingelseaboutGreenland'sblanketofice:
Becausetheicemeltsfromthetopdown,thesurfaceelevationgetslowerovertime.Andatlowerelevations,theairgenerallyiswarmer.
"AsGreenlandislosingice,itgetsmoreandmoreirreversible,"Csathoexplains,"becauseyougettheiceintolowerandlowerelevations."
Theresearchshowssomeexceptionstothewarmingtrend—placeswhereiceisbuildingbackuportemperaturesarecooling.Butoverall,warmingiswinningintheArctic.
